The Main Man's Latest Hunt

Lobo, the self-proclaimed 'Main Man,' has carved a unique niche in the DC Universe since his debut. Originating from the planet Czarnia, which he single-handedly annihilated, Lobo is a character defined by his unparalleled strength, regeneration, and a dark, often humorous, sense of nihilism. Historically, he operates outside the conventional moral strictures, serving as a bounty hunter whose allegiances are as fluid as his temperament. His previous appearances have seen him clash with a myriad of villains, cosmic entities, and even other anti-heroes, but rarely, if ever, has he been pitted directly against a widely recognized, traditionally heroic figure from the Justice League's roster in such a direct and adversarial capacity. This new series aims to redefine his role, pushing him beyond mere intergalactic brawls into a conflict with deeper, more symbolic implications.

The Firestorm Revelation

The superhero confirmed to be Lobo's unexpected foe is none other than <b>Firestorm</b>, the Nuclear Man. Firestorm, typically a composite being formed by the fusion of two individuals (most famously Ronnie Raymond and Professor Martin Stein, or later Jason Rusch and Stein), wields incredible power over matter and energy, capable of transmuting elements and generating powerful energy blasts. Known for his unwavering moral compass and commitment to justice, Firestorm has been a stalwart member of various iterations of the Justice League. His involvement as an antagonist to Lobo is particularly jarring, given his history as a champion of peace and his scientific, measured approach to conflict. The idea of Firestorm being directly at odds with Lobo, whose methods are anything but measured, sets the stage for a volatile and ideologically charged confrontation that will undoubtedly push both characters to their limits.

A Battle of Ideals and Power

From a power dynamics perspective, the fight promises to be spectacular. Lobo’s raw, almost limitless physical strength, combined with his near-instantaneous regeneration, makes him a formidable opponent. He is a brawler, relying on brute force and a cavalier disregard for pain. Firestorm, on the other hand, operates on a different level. His ability to restructure matter at a subatomic level gives him unparalleled offensive and defensive capabilities. He can turn Lobo’s weapons into harmless objects, erect force fields, or even directly manipulate Lobo’s molecular structure (though this is often constrained by a 'transmutation limit' on living beings). This clash of elemental precision against untamed savagery ensures a visually stunning and strategically complex battle, where victory will likely hinge not just on power, but on wits and resolve.
